A BEAR

I saw a bear this weekend. I was on the Long Beach Peninsula and I was driving toward Leadbetter park, just north of Oysterville, where my friend Dennis Driscoll resides sometimes. I have never seen a real bear in the real wild. There were actually a family of bears. 3 of them. Looked like a Mom and two adolescent cubs. Here's a photo from the driver's seat:
GetAttachment  That is a real bear. NOT a guy in a costume.
